Hookah Services In Delhi Restaurants To Be Banned Soon By The Government!

According to the new law issued by the government on 23rd May, hookah service will discontinued at airports, hotels & restaurants. Not just this, but all the hotels, restaurants & airports are supposed put a display board outside their smoking zones. The display must say saying smoking tobacco is injurious to health!

30 Second Window:

  • The government took this step after realising that properties across Delhi were offering hookah by bypassing the current law. The law previous to the 23rd May ruling stated that in smoking zones only smoking will be allowed & no other services!
  • Also, the step was taken by the government in order to improve the public health & put a stop to underage smoking.
  • It is believed that pollution rate will also fall down with the help of this law. And will significantly improve Delhites’ lifestyle.
